UPVC Door Hinges

There are a lot of options with regard to Upvc door hinges. These options include Flag hinges, Butt hinges, Rebate hinges, and Mortise hinges.

Butt hinges

UPVC doors are usually fitted with butt hinges, sometimes referred to as edge or pencil hinges. These hinges are located on the edge of the door and allow for lateral adjustment. There are numerous brands to choose from, such as Paddock, WMS and Avocet.

There's a high chance that your door isn't opening or closing effortlessly. Modern slimline adjustable hinges can be used to replace old profile door hinges.

There are also traditional flags and rebated door hinges. Both hinges offer lateral and vertical adjustment. The hinges that are flags are usually used on newer uPVC door models. Rebated hinges are slowly disappearing from the scene.

Two main reasons a doors won't close completely are the force of gravity and heat. To solve this issue you'll need to open the door to about 90 degrees , then move it until it is in a straight line. Then you'll need to tighten the hinge screws.

An Allen key can be used to alter the height of your door. This can be done without removing the sash from the frame. When looking at hinges, there are some important aspects to take into consideration for instance, how much weight each hinge is able to carry.

Mortise hinges

Mortise hinges are a good choice if you need an effective installation solution for doors with heavy weight. They are made of carbon steel or stainless steel and are a great option for harsh environments. They are available in different finishes to be a perfect match to your home's decor.

There are two typesof hinges: half and full mortise hinges. Full mortise hinges are fitted flush into a door frame. Half mortise hinges can be made inside a door, and only have one leaf sticking out of the door.

Mortise hinges can be put in place quickly. You can make use of a router or jig to complete the job. Make sure that the hinge's hole is in the proper depth.

After you have determined the depth of the hole, you can start by drawing the outline of the hinge. A chisel as well as a utility knife work well. It is crucial to make cuts that are at minimum 1/8 inch apart. This is to make your mortise deeper. To finish the cut, gently tap the chisel using a hammer.

Flag hinges

There are numerous styles of door hinges. Each type comes with its pros and cons. The most effective results can be achieved by selecting the best hinge.

Flag hinges are a popular choice for uPVC doors. They can withstand heavy loads and offer an excellent level of security. However, these hinges may not work with certain kinds of uPVC door. Therefore, it's important to find the appropriate replacement for your particular door.

Flag hinges are available in many different sizes and colors. Flag hinges are also available with compression adjustment. They are available at online stores and builders merchants.

Easy installation of UPVC door flag hinges is possible. The compression adjustment is located in the middle of the hinge rather than along the edges like edge-like butt hinges. It can be hidden behind plastic covers. To adjust it remove the two Phillips screws from the hinge's inner. After you have removed the screws, loosen the pins locking the hinge. This will allow you to unlock the Allen screws.

Then, you must determine which screws are responsible for which adjustment. This will allow you to adjust the door to correct warping or draughts.

Also, make sure that the gap between the frame and the door is equal. By using a spirit-level, you can pinpoint the exact gap. If the gap is uneven, it will not be able to be closed completely.

The majority of the time butt hinges are found on older uPVC doors. However, they can also be utilized on modern doors. Some hinges have only lateral adjustment.

The ideal uPVC flag hinge is one that has three dimensional adjustment. This lets you fit your sash lid correctly and makes the installation easy. The hinge pin in steel is precisely tuned to ensure maximum compression.
